C#SQLite学习资料:拆分的可执行程序exe

版权申诉
0 下载量 186 浏览量 更新于2024-10-26 收藏 5.51MB RAR 举报
资源摘要信息:"该资源是关于C#和SQLite的可执行程序,文件名为exe。它包含了SQLite的学习资料,对于想要学习SQLite的开发者来说是一个非常重要的学习资源。SQLite是一个轻量级的数据库,它不需要一个单独的服务器进程或系统,可以直接嵌入到应用程序中使用,这使得它在需要简单数据库解决方案的应用程序中非常受欢迎。同时,C#是一种广泛使用的编程语言,它强大的功能和灵活性使得开发者可以创建各种类型的应用程序。在使用C#和SQLite进行开发时,开发者可以利用SQLite的强大功能和C#的高效编程特性,创建出强大、稳定、易于维护的应用程序。" 在理解了该资源的基本信息后,我们可以进一步详细探讨C#和SQLite这两个重要的知识点。 首先,SQLite是一种轻型数据库,它最大的特点就是不需要一个单独的服务器进程或者系统,可以被直接嵌入到应用程序中使用。这就使得SQLite在需要轻量级数据库的应用场景中非常有用,如小型项目、移动应用、桌面应用等。SQLite支持标准的SQL语言,拥有事务处理的能力,同时还具备了触发器、事务和视图等特性。这些特性使得SQLite不仅仅是简单的文件存储机制,而是一个功能完整的数据库系统。 SQLite的另一个显著特点是它的跨平台性。SQLite可以在几乎所有的操作系统上运行,包括Windows、MacOS、Linux、Android和iOS等。此外,SQLite对数据类型的支持比较灵活,没有严格的类型约束。它对SQL92的实现程度很高,几乎所有的SQL92标准SQLite都能支持。 关于SQLite的学习资源,开发者可以通过查阅SQLite官方文档来获得最权威、最详细的数据库操作指南。此外,网络上也有很多关于SQLite的教学视频和教程,以及一些开源项目中提供了丰富的使用案例和最佳实践。 再来看C#,它是微软公司开发的一种面向对象的编程语言,是.NET平台的核心语言之一。C#在设计上吸取了多种语言的优点,如C++、Java和Delphi等,它具有类型安全、版本控制、垃圾回收等特性,使得编写大型程序变得更加容易。C#语言支持多种编程范式,包括面向对象、命令式、函数式、泛型等编程模式。 在使用C#操作SQLite数据库时,开发者通常会使用***技术或Entity Framework。***提供了一组类库,使得开发者能够通过编程方式访问数据源。通过System.Data.SQLite这个库,开发者可以让C#程序直接连接SQLite数据库,并进行数据操作。System.Data.SQLite是SQLite的.NET封装,它将SQLite数据库引擎直接编译为一个本地的.NET程序集,允许开发者用C#代码操作SQLite数据库。 学习C#和SQLite,不仅可以帮助开发者创建高效能、轻量级的应用程序,还可以加深对数据库编程和面向对象编程的理解。特别是在移动开发和桌面应用开发领域,掌握这两种技术将非常有帮助。开发者通过实践操作SQLite数据库,可以学习到如何设计数据库模式、执行SQL语句、处理数据连接和事务等关键技能。同时,C#的面向对象编程能力将让数据库编程变得更加灵活和可重用。 此外,对本资源的进一步了解,可以包括如何使用SQLite管理工具,例如SQLite Browser等,来辅助开发和学习过程。这些工具可以帮助开发者进行数据库的设计,以及执行SQL语句,查看数据库结构和数据等。 总结来说,该资源“exe.rar_c# sqlite”是一个宝贵的学习资料,特别是对于那些希望深入学习C#和SQLite的开发者。通过这份资源,开发者可以学习到如何使用SQLite数据库,并通过C#语言将其集成到应用程序中,进一步提升自己的开发技能。